  • Where can I setup a default RDP client?

    Every time want to connect to a remote desktop, an app automatically opens. This app is CoRD, I want to use another app.
    CoRD isn't even installed in my prohremas-folder.
    Where can i setup another RDP client?

    When CoRD is running it will appear in the Dock (normally at the bottom of your screen). If you click and hold on the Icon you will get a menu appear and there should be a choice to 'Show in Finder' this will show you where the CoRD application is and you can then if you wish throw it away.
    However more specifically to setting the default RDP app. I think what is happening is you are double-clicking or otherwise opening a settings file which contains the settings to connect to a specific RDP host. If you click once on the settings file and then select Get Info, in the Get Info window should be an option to specify which program to open the settings file with. You would then change it presumably to Microsoft Remote Desktop instead of CoRD.

  • Using different port number in RDP Client

    I was successfully able to change the RDP port for my windows server 2012 R2 following this: http://support2.microsoft.com/kb/306759
    I am also able to RDP to from windows (XP, Windows , etc) default RDP client by providing <ipAddress>:<portNumber>.
    My issue is when I open my clients in front of others they can easily see the port number I am using for RDP. How can I change the settings in my RDP client so that I don't have to provide port number and it knows that it has to connect to this different
    port to RDP?

    Easiest way 
    Install Remote Desktop Connection Manager and configure the servername with portnumber (This is onetime configuration).
    Download RDConnection Manager from : http://www.microsoft.com/en-us/download/details.aspx?id=21101
    OR 
    You can save thie RDP shortcut icon for a respective server.
    Open RDP console,Click on show options,
    Enter the name of remote computer name with portnumber
    If required specify username, 
    Click on Save As,
    Save it on Desktop or as per your convenience.
    Whenever if you want to connect to the server, Just double click on RDP icon where you have saved. it will not show you portnumber, it will prompt for username / password.

  • Remote App and Desktop RDP client never succeed to logon the RDS gateway server running Windows 2012R2

    Remote App and Desktop RDP client never succeed to logon the RDS gateway server running Windows 2012R2
    1. Client Os : Windows 7 Pro
    2. Server OS : Windows Server 2012R2 with RDS broker and RDS Gateway server with 3.part Certificate  with friendly name sky.mti-itservice.no activated.
    The  main problem is following: The RDP logon session never ends
    Any ideas ?
    Regards
    Kenneth Knudsen
    Email : [email protected]
    mvh Kenneth Knudsen MCSE 2003 HP ASE

    Hi Kenneth,
    Here for your case suggest you to configure RDP session time limit so that your user can disconnect\log off once the specific time limit reached.
    You can setup the session time limit in different method.
    1. Open the Server Manager, select Remote Desktop Services.
    2. In Remote desktop Services, in right side you can drop down to collections.
    3. Select the collection which you want to edit the settings.
    4. Under collections Properties, select Task and then Edit Properties.
    5. In Properties dialog box, select Session.
    6. You can find all thetimeout settings under session collection properties; edit according to your requirements and then OK. 
    And apart also by group policy setting as below.
    Computer Configuration\Policies\Administrative Templates\Windows Components\Remote Desktop Services\Remote Desktop Session Host\Session Time Limits 
    User Configuration\Policies\Administrative Templates\Windows Components\Remote Desktop Services\Remote Desktop Session Host\Session Time Limits 
    -  Set time limit for disconnected sessions
    -  Set time limit for active but idle Remote Desktop Services sessions
    -  Set time limit for active Remote Desktop Services sessions
    -  End session when time limits are reached
    Please check which setting suitable for your environment and you can apply for your case.

  • How to use RDP client through a proxy ?

    Hi,
    we have some users in our LAN that have to connect to external RDP servers.
    Those servers don't use RDP Gateway (and we are not the owner of those servers).
    We dont want to open specific trafic from our LAN to those IP Adress on port 3389; we prefer to let this trafic goes through our proxy server (for security reason, because the direct connection will not be supervised).
    So, my question is : Is there a way to configure the RDP Client (the official one or another one) to connect through a local proxy instead of trying to directly connect to the external IP address of the RDP Server ? 
    Thank you

    You could do this with an ssh tunnel and putty very easily. Most web proxies won't actually allow port forwarding like that and restricted to 80 and 443.
    If you want to know how to do it with a ssh tunnel and putty let me know.
    Opening outgoing 3389 from one internal subnet to specific external IP is not such a security risk. Just don't open inbound 3389 from those hosts and you should be fine?
    I am not sure if outbound RDP will require inbound ports to be opened. Its quite rare that any external RDP is opened in my experience as its such a security risk (on the part of the external rdp hosts).
    ITs much better to VPN to the external hosts then initiate local (via vpn) rdp connections.

  • OS/X RDP client feature request - Applescript support

    The new OS/X RDP client is very nice overall, but it can't be easily scripted. You can get most of the way there using OS/X UI scripting:
    tell application "Microsoft Remote Desktop"
    activate
    tell application "System Events"
    set frontmost of process "Microsoft Remote Desktop" to true
    tell process "Microsoft Remote Desktop"
    keystroke "f" using {command down}
    keystroke "a" using {command down} -- select all
    key code 51 -- delete
    keystroke item 1 of argv --search query
    keystroke tab
    key code 126 -- up
    key code 125 -- down
    key code 36 --enter
    end tell
    end tell
    end tell
    But UI scripting is brittle. For example, the recent update to the RDP client pops up a dialog box announcing the new changes - that breaks the UI scripting. You have to launch the app and clear the dialog box before the UI scripting starts working again.
    It would be much simpler and far more reliable if the OS/X RDP client supported Applescript to both list desktops and to connect to a desktop.
